Red Light Panel Therapy: What to Expect

Red light therapy, also known as low-level laser therapy or photobiomodulation, is a non-invasive treatment that uses red light wavelengths to promote healing and overall wellness. As more and more people are turning to alternative therapies for various health conditions, red light panel therapy has gained popularity for its potential benefits. In this article, we will explore what to expect from red light panel therapy and how it may improve your overall well-being.

Understanding Red Light Panel Therapy

Red light therapy involves exposing the skin to low levels of red or near-infrared light. This light penetrates the skin and is absorbed by the cells, where it stimulates the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the energy currency of the cell. This boost in cellular energy can help improve cellular function and promote healing. Red light therapy has been studied for its potential benefits in accelerating wound healing, reducing inflammation, and relieving pain.

Red light panel therapy utilizes specially designed LED panels that emit red and near-infrared light. These panels are typically large and can cover a significant area of the body, allowing for more comprehensive treatment compared to handheld devices. Red light panel therapy is often used in spas, wellness centers, and even in the comfort of your own home with the availability of at-home devices.

The Benefits of Red Light Panel Therapy

Red light panel therapy has been studied for a variety of potential benefits, ranging from skin rejuvenation to pain relief. Some of the key benefits of red light panel therapy include improved skin health, enhanced muscle recovery, reduced inflammation, and increased circulation. The therapy has also shown promise in promoting hair growth, improving joint health, and supporting overall wellness.

One of the primary benefits of red light panel therapy is its ability to stimulate collagen production in the skin. Collagen is a protein that helps maintain the skin's elasticity and firmness, making it an essential component for youthful-looking skin. By promoting collagen production, red light therapy can help reduce the appearance of wrinkles, fine lines, and other signs of aging. Additionally, red light therapy can help improve skin tone, texture, and clarity, making it a popular treatment for acne, rosacea, and other skin conditions.

What to Expect During a Red Light Panel Therapy Session

During a red light panel therapy session, you will be asked to sit or lie down in front of the LED panel, exposing the area of your body that requires treatment. The therapist may position the panel at a specific distance from your skin to ensure optimal light penetration. The session typically lasts for a predetermined amount of time, usually ranging from a few minutes to half an hour, depending on the treatment area and the desired outcomes.

As the red and near-infrared light penetrates your skin, you may feel a mild warmth or tingling sensation. This is normal and is a sign that the light is stimulating the cells and initiating the healing process. Some people also report feeling relaxed and rejuvenated during a red light panel therapy session, making it a pleasant and soothing experience. After the session, you can immediately resume your daily activities without any downtime, making red light panel therapy a convenient treatment option for busy individuals.

How Often Should You Undergo Red Light Panel Therapy

The frequency of red light panel therapy sessions can vary depending on your specific goals and the severity of your condition. For general wellness maintenance and skin rejuvenation, a weekly or bi-weekly session may be sufficient to achieve noticeable improvements. However, if you are seeking relief from chronic pain or a specific health condition, you may benefit from more frequent sessions, such as two to three times per week.

It is essential to work with a qualified healthcare provider or licensed therapist to determine the most appropriate treatment plan for your needs. They can assess your condition, recommend the optimal treatment frequency, and monitor your progress to ensure that you are getting the most out of your red light panel therapy sessions. Consistency is key when it comes to red light therapy, so sticking to a regular treatment schedule will help you maximize the benefits and achieve long-lasting results.

Potential Side Effects and Considerations

While red light panel therapy is generally safe and well-tolerated, there are some potential side effects and considerations to be aware of. Some people may experience mild redness, warmth, or sensitivity in the treated area following a session, but these symptoms typically subside within a few hours. In rare cases, individuals with photosensitivity or certain skin conditions may experience adverse reactions to red light therapy, so it is essential to consult with a healthcare provider before starting treatment.

It is also crucial to follow the manufacturer's instructions for the use of at-home red light panel devices to ensure safe and effective treatment. Using the device at the correct distance, for the recommended duration, and at the proper intensity can help prevent adverse effects and maximize the therapy's benefits. If you have any concerns or questions about red light panel therapy, do not hesitate to seek guidance from a qualified healthcare professional or therapist.
